免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

app 前端开发架构是什么岗位

APP前端开发架构是指针对移动端应用的前端框架和技术栈的整体设计和组织结构。它规范了前端的开发流程和代码编写规范,并为项目的可扩展性和维护性提供了保障。在一个APP的前端开发过程中,架构师负责设计整个前端的技术架构和开发流程,并指导团队进行具体的开发实现。

APP前端开发架构师所要掌握的技能包括:移动端开发知识、前端技术栈、前端架构设计、性能优化等等。下面我们来详细介绍一下APP前端开发架构师的岗位职责和技术要求。

一、岗位职责

1.全局架构设计:APP前端开发架构师需要搭建一套完整的前端架构,这些架构不仅要满足业务需求和用户使用流畅度等指标,同时还要考虑资金投入和项目周期等因素。

2.开发规范管理:指导团队建立一套标准化开发规范,如编码规范、文件管理规范、版本控制规范等,从而保证文档的统一规范,代码的风格统一。

3.技术选型:根据项目需求进行技术选型,选择最适合实际应用的技术。同时也需要考虑技术的可持续性、可维护性、成熟程度等因素。

4.团队管理:APP前端开发架构师需要拥有一定的管理能力和团队合作意识,协调各个小组之间的合作,管理完成质量。

5.需求评审和实现过程监控:需求评审的目的就是明确需求,确保开发方案的可行性,开发方案是符合优秀前端开发实践的规范。实现过程监控的目标是:实现过程中的问题及时发现并解决,确保实现速度和质量,并随时调整开发方案。

二、技术要求

1.移动端开发知识:APP前端开发架构师必须对移动端开发具有基本的了解,并且要熟练掌握Android或iOS等平台的基础知识以及本地特性。

2.前端技术栈:掌握HTML5/CSS3/JavaScript等前端技术栈,深入理解各种前端框架和UI组件的实现原理。

3.前端架构设计:理解前端架构和设计模式,有过架构设计方案的经验。

4.性能优化:具备深入了解前端优化手段,作为专家为优化提供建议,整合业界新优化方案。

5.沟通协作:负责项目开发中与项目部门和组成员的沟通协调,能够很好地理解业务,针对性地提出前端架构建议。

我们可以看到,APP前端开发架构师岗位要求技能全面,不仅需要具备扎实的技术基础,而且还需要具备一些非技术层面的能力,如团队合作、沟通协作等。在快速更新换代的移动互联网领域,APP前端开发架构师还需要保持不断学习、跟进技术发展的态度。


相关知识:
山东视频剪辑app开发语言
山东视频剪辑app开发语言是指在开发这个应用程序的过程中所采用的编程语言。在开发视频剪辑app时,需要使用到多种编程语言,包括前端开发语言、后端开发语言和移动端开发语言。下面将详细介绍这些语言的原理和特点。一、前端开发语言前端开发语言主要用于开发应用程序的
2024-01-10
山东app定制开发全国加盟
随着移动互联网的快速发展,手机APP已经成为了人们日常生活中不可或缺的一部分。APP可以为用户提供各种各样的服务,比如购物、社交、出行等等。在这个背景下,APP定制开发成为了一个非常热门的行业。山东是一个经济发达的省份,APP定制开发市场也非常活跃。本文将
2024-01-10
企业级app组件化开发3
组件化开发是当今企业级App开发中的一大趋势。本文将从原理和详细介绍两个方面来讲解企业级App组件化开发。一、原理组件化开发是将一个大型的App项目拆分成多个小型的模块,这些模块可以独立开发、测试和维护。每个模块都是一个独立的组件,可以被其他组件依赖和使用
2024-01-10
app开发技术公司招聘
随着智能手机和平板电脑等移动设备的普及,移动应用程序变得越来越受欢迎。由于移动应用程序的需求增加,市场上对移动应用程序开发人员的需求也越来越高。这也导致了app开发公司越来越多。接下来,我们将详细介绍一下app开发技术公司的招聘。1.岗位职责app开发技术
2023-06-29
app的开发周期有多久
移动应用程序(APP)正在不断扩大其应用范围,它们能够在各种场景下提供创新和优化的解决方案,并为企业/机构/个人的数字化转型和业务增长提供支持。APP的开发周期受多个因素的影响,如应用类型、复杂性、技术栈、需求分析、设计,开发和测试等软件开发阶段的长度和成
2023-05-06
app定制开发的六个步骤
App定制开发是根据客户的需求进行开发的移动应用程序。它旨在为客户提供个性化的应用,满足其特定的业务需求。本文将介绍关于App定制开发的六个步骤。第一步:确定需求在定制任何应用程序之前,我们需要明确客户的需求。我们应该与客户进行详细的谈判,以确定他们希望应
2023-05-06